![]() wrote There were no guns stolen from an airplane and none kept in an airplane. The guns stolen were taken from a hangar with an office sometimes used as a place to over nite when the owner needs to avoid traveling to and from the big city. The thieves had to pick three locks to get to them. One lock to get inside the hangar, one lock to get inside the office, one lock to get inside the desk. One of the locks was a locked steel desk with the three handguns in the drawer. The shotgun was used for over nite protection. This is an isolated airport miles away from the town. None of the handguns were loaded or had ammunition with them. There is no doubt in my mind, that someone who knew you did this, because they had to have known the location of the guns, to go through all of those layers. -- Jim in NC |
